8181171: Deleting method for RedefineClasses breaks ResolvedMethodName

8210457: JVM crash in ResolvedMethodTable::add_method(Handle)

Add a function to call NSME in ResolvedMethodTable to replace deleted methods.

Reviewed-by: sspitsyn, dholmes, dcubed

/*
* @test
* @bug 8181171
* @summary Test deleting static method pointing to by a jmethod
* @library /test/lib
* @modules java.base/jdk.internal.misc
* @modules java.compiler
* java.instrument
* jdk.jartool/sun.tools.jar
* @run main RedefineClassHelper
* @run main/native/othervm -javaagent:redefineagent.jar -Xlog:redefine+class*=trace RedefineDeleteJmethod
*/
class B {
private static int deleteMe() { System.out.println("deleteMe called"); return 5; }
public static int callDeleteMe() { return deleteMe(); }
}
public class RedefineDeleteJmethod {
public static String newB =
"class B {" +
"public static int callDeleteMe() { return 6; }" +
"}";
public static String newerB =
"class B {" +
"private static int deleteMe() { System.out.println(\"deleteMe (2) called\"); return 7; }" +
"public static int callDeleteMe() { return deleteMe(); }" +
"}";
static {
System.loadLibrary("RedefineDeleteJmethod");
}
static native int jniCallDeleteMe();
static void test(int expected, boolean nsme_expected) throws Exception {
// Call through static method
int res = B.callDeleteMe();
System.out.println("Result = " + res);
if (res != expected) {
throw new Error("returned " + res + " expected " + expected);
}
// Call through jmethodID, saved from first call.
try {
res = jniCallDeleteMe();
if (nsme_expected) {
throw new RuntimeException("Failed, NoSuchMethodError expected");
}
if (res != expected) {
throw new Error("returned " + res + " expected " + expected);
}
} catch (NoSuchMethodError ex) {
if (!nsme_expected) {
throw new RuntimeException("Failed, NoSuchMethodError not expected");
}
System.out.println("Passed, NoSuchMethodError expected");
}
}
public static void main(String[] args) throws Exception {
test(5, false);
RedefineClassHelper.redefineClass(B.class, newB);
test(6, true);
RedefineClassHelper.redefineClass(B.class, newerB);
test(7, true);
}
}

/*
* @test
* @bug 8181171
* @summary Break ResolvedMethodTable with redefined nest class.
* @library /test/lib
* @modules java.base/jdk.internal.misc
* @modules java.compiler
* java.instrument
* jdk.jartool/sun.tools.jar
* @compile ../../NamedBuffer.java
* @compile redef/Xost.java
* @run main RedefineClassHelper
* @run main/othervm -javaagent:redefineagent.jar -Xlog:redefine+class+update*=debug,membername+table=debug MethodHandleDeletedMethod
*/
import java.io.File;
import java.io.FileInputStream;
import java.lang.invoke.*;
class Host {
static MethodHandle fooMH;
static class A {
private static void foo() { System.out.println("OLD foo called"); }
}
static void bar() throws NoSuchMethodError {
A.foo();
}
static void barMH() throws Throwable {
fooMH.invokeExact();
}
public static void reresolve() throws Throwable {
fooMH = MethodHandles.lookup().findStatic(A.class, "foo", MethodType.methodType(void.class));
}
static {
try {
fooMH = MethodHandles.lookup().findStatic(A.class, "foo", MethodType.methodType(void.class));
} catch (ReflectiveOperationException ex) {
}
}
}
public class MethodHandleDeletedMethod {
static final String DEST = System.getProperty("test.classes");
static final boolean VERBOSE = false;
private static byte[] bytesForHostClass(char replace) throws Throwable {
return NamedBuffer.bytesForHostClass(replace, "Host$A");
}
public static void main(java.lang.String[] unused) throws Throwable {
Host h = new Host();
h.bar();
h.barMH();
byte[] buf = bytesForHostClass('X');
RedefineClassHelper.redefineClass(Host.A.class, buf);
try {
h.bar(); // call deleted Method directly
throw new RuntimeException("Failed, expected NSME");
} catch (NoSuchMethodError nsme) {
System.out.println("Received expected NSME");
}
try {
h.barMH(); // call through MethodHandle for deleted Method
throw new RuntimeException("Failed, expected NSME");
} catch (NoSuchMethodError nsme) {
System.out.println("Received expected NSME");
}
System.out.println("Passed.");
}
}
